About the Project

Hello everyone, I'm Overlord Kaktus/Gold/Ruki Studios. Probably you remember me for other projects like Pokémon Ragnarök (Or maybe not hahaha). I'm a Spanish-speaker romhacker and a former GBC romhacker (from 2010 to May 2014). This time I'll show to you guys an old project that I decided to restart, and I really hope this project would be finished.

This project was started around late 2010. At that moment the project was only an "idea" that was stopped in 2015, but now it was redone from scratch.

The project is highly inspirated in the Chaos Rush's hack "Pokemon Dark Violet". in other words, this hack is also a "reboot" (Or try to be) of Pokemon Gold, Silver and Crystal, making many of the events from scratch and showing a new storyline keeping the escence of the original story, with a heavy inspiration of the original HGSS remakes and some concepts seen only in Polished Crystal.

Keep in your mind, this isn't a remake like Liquid Crystal, CrystalDust or ShinyGold. This intends to be a reboot from Pokemon Gold and Silver, using some ideas from Pokémon Crystal and HGSS, making a unique and unseen story of Johto.

What is New?

Proudly powered by the Complete Fire Red Upgrade​

• A renewed storyline, keeping the essence of the original games with a few new characters.

• New events never seen before in any GSC remake.

• Maps based off HGSS ones.

• Introducing the Mega Evolution mechanics in the main storyline + Z Moves during the Kanto Post game (Maybe Dynamax/Gigamax, idk).

• Day and Night system and day/time-based events.

• Wild Pokémon switching depending on the time.

• Original soundtrack ripped from HGSS (Initially used GogojjTech's low quality music, but I decided to rip them by myself with a way better quality).

• Physical/Special split moves.

• New Regional Pokedex including Over Pokémon from the first 4 gens + new gen evolutions/regional forms.

• New GS Chronicles exclusive Mega evolutions! (No fakemon will be featured, nor regional forms)

• Introducing the PokéRides, Items that replace the outdated HM mechanics by calling a wild Pokémon that will temporarily join you to help you.

• All new Gen 4-8 Moves included, a few GS Chronicles exclusive moves are included.

• Several Pokemon with altered BST and movesets to make them more viable for a casual gameplay (i.e. Ledyba stats and movesets were buffed due to the original stats made it an awful Pokemon, even for a casual player)

• Type chart updated to include the Fairy-type.

• New puzzles for some areas.

• Plenty of updated graphics (like Battle backgrounds, bag, Trainer card, almost everything).

• Most trainers use different rosters from original HGSS/GSC to match new Pokedex.

• New locations in Johto and Kanto.

• Most menu interfaces updated to match the HGSS design language.

• New locations for some Pokémon.

• In-battle trainer messages.

• An almost working PokéGear (Pending to implement a working a Phone card, and an improved radio card).

• Exp. Share and exp. Gain identical to Gen 8 (Item is disabled by default, easy to enable).

• Mechanics, items and more almost updated to match Gen 8 games.

• Trade with Pokemon Unbound and other CFRU-based games using the Unbound Cloud.

• Option for relearn moves and nickname your Pokemon directly from the party menu
